Presents multiple viewpoints surrounding teen pregnancy, including the factors behind teen pregnancy, the best approach to reduce teen pregnancy, and the impact on teen mothers and fathers.

A graphic novel adaptation of Robert Louis Stevenson's "Kidnapped," about David Balfour, who is kidnapped and thrown onto a ship, but manages to escape and make his way back through Scotland.

"Anna Maria Weems was just a teenager when she was given the opportunity to escape her enslaver in the mid-1800s. The journey would be dangerous, but she would have the help of abolitionists along the way. One of those supporters had a novel idea--Anna Maria would escape to freedom disguised as a boy. Learn about her brave journey on the Underground Railroad in this inspiring graphic novel"--
